Job description

Job Overview

Join a leading technology company in Bengaluru as a Scala Developer responsible for designing and building robust software solutions. Ideal candidates will have strong expertise in Scala and functional programming, with a solid foundation in data structures, algorithms, and problem-solving approaches.

Preferred Skills and Experiences

  • Hands-on experience with message-oriented middleware such as Kafka, AMQP, MQ, or AMPS.
  • Background in distributed systems architecture and development.
  • Familiarity with web application technologies including JavaScript, AngularJS, and Bootstrap.
  • Competence in designing and developing REST APIs.
  • Experience with Domain-Driven Design (DDD), Command Query Responsibility Segregation (CQRS), and event-sourced systems.
  • Exposure to banking middle or back-office industry domains.
  • Proficiency in scripting languages like Bash and Python.
  • Knowledge of automated deployment tools such as Ansible, Puppet, Chef, and Docker.
  • Experience with Scala-specific third-party libraries and frameworks including Scalactic, Scalatra, Akka, RxScala, and TypeLevel libraries.
  • Understanding of Category Theory principles relevant to functional programming.
  • A minimum of five years of professional experience working with Scala or other functional programming languages.
  • Practice in writing unit tests and behavioral/acceptance tests.
  • Demonstrated ability to deliver high-quality code within deadlines.
  • Experience working in agile environments involving pair programming and daily stand-ups.
  • Proven domain knowledge acquired from previous employment experience.
  • Collaborative experience working in teams with shared codebases and continuous integration processes.
  • Willingness to take part in production support rotations.
  • Comfort and experience working in Linux/Unix environments.
